Dear Mr. Zerr:

f Pursuant to 10 C.F.R. 13.7 and 31 U.S.C.-3802, I hereby serve i

notice upon you of.my intention to refer the enclosed complaint, j

alleging violations of the Program Fraud Civil Remedies Act,- to the Administrative Law Judge for the United States Nuclear Regulatory Commission, not less than 30 days from your receipt of r

this complaint.

As is explained in the Complaint and the regulations attacheo thereto, you may request a hearing within that thirty-day period.

Failure to do so will result in your possible waiver of that i

right.
